Santa Maria Style BBQ is a lifestyle and a way of life for local BBQ's at the 2nd Annual Los Alamos Valley Men's Club BBQ Competition. Salt, Pepper and Garlic are the main ingredients for their rubs and resting the meat before cutting is a key factor for the overall tenderness and appearance.

When making a fall style meal using a fall spice like cardamom, cinnamon or nutmeg your wine selection changes. During the Fall season we choose a lighter body red and a heavier bodied white wine more often than any other time of year. What is blended wine? Blends are wines that do not carry a single varietal designation. Some of the finest wines in the world are actually wine blends. Bordeaux blends and Rhone blends are some of the most famous but here in California Opus One and Joseph Phelps in the Napa Valley have honed their skills creating phenomenal wine blends themselves.
